What you will be doing
As our Treasury Legal Counsel, you’ll play a key role in supporting Pepper Money’s debt capital markets activity, helping shape and maintain the funding structures that underpin our mortgage business. Working closely with our Treasurer, Treasury team, and external counsel, you’ll ensure transactions are executed efficiently, legal risks are well-managed, and our funding platforms remain robust and compliant.
You will:
- Support the Treasurer in managing legal risk across the Pepper UK business.
- Draft, review and negotiate documentation for securitisations, warehouses, forward flow arrangements and other funding structures.
- Lead or support the legal workstream for RMBS transactions (Castell & Polaris), warehouses, whole loan sales and derivative structures.
- Advise on the legal aspects of new funding structures, treasury initiatives and capital markets issuance.
- Ensure compliance with applicable regulatory frameworks, including UK Securitisation Regulation and PRA/FCA requirements.
- Provide legal input on mortgage product design, origination policies, collateral eligibility and investor expectations.
- Support investor due diligence processes and respond to legal queries from arrangers, rating agencies and institutional investors.
- Manage external counsel relationships, ensuring efficient and commercially focused delivery.
- Review and negotiate ISDA documentation, CSAs and other risk‑management agreements.
- Contribute to internal governance processes including ALCO, Credit Committee and Product Governance.
What we are looking for
We’re looking for a commercially minded legal professional with deep experience in structured finance and debt capital markets. You’ll thrive in a fast‑paced environment, enjoy solving complex problems, and be confident dealing with senior internal and external stakeholders.
You will bring:
- Qualified solicitor status with strong experience in securitisation, structured finance or debt capital markets.
- Strong drafting and negotiation skills, with the ability to communicate complex legal issues clearly.
- Experience working on RMBS or other asset‑backed transactions.
- Understanding of treasury operations, hedging and liquidity management.
- Exposure to private credit markets or whole‑loan sales (advantageous).
- Knowledge of UK regulatory frameworks affecting securitisation and mortgage lending.
- Ability to manage multiple transactions, deadlines and stakeholders in a fast‑moving environment.
- Experience working in‑house within a lender, bank or financial institution (preferred).
- Familiarity with specialist mortgage products such as BTL, second charge or non‑prime.
- Personal qualities including a commercial mindset, strong stakeholder management, attention to detail, and a solutions‑focused approach.
